About the Winemaker

Laurent Saillard is a natural winemaker based in Monthou-sur-Cher in the Loire Valley, where he creates some of the region's most celebrated minimal-intervention wines.

Originally from the Loire, Laurent worked for years in the New York City restaurant industry before returning to France to pursue winemaking. He was mentored by Noella Morantin and has built a reputation for wines of remarkable purity and energy, working with varieties like Sauvignon Blanc, Côt (Malbec), and Gamay.

Farming & Cellar: Laurent farms organically and uses biodynamic preparations, hand-harvesting all fruit. Wines are fermented with native yeasts in various vessels including clay amphora, aged without new oak, and bottled with minimal or zero sulfites—unfined and unfiltered.
